Bhubaneswar, the temple city of India, is famous for its appliquรฉ work, food, festivals specially car festival. Bhubaneswar is Scenic, lively, green and clean, with a rich cultural life and the Buddhist and Hindu pilgrimage centre.
Bhubaneswar is capital city of the Indian state Odhisa0. Founded during the Kalinga Empire over 3,000 years ago, Bhubaneswar today boasts of a cluster of magnificent temples, Once known for its architecture and grand temples, Bhubaneswar is now centre for business .The city is most known for hosting Ratha Yatra which attracts thousands of devotees. Along with Konark and Puri Bhubaneswar completes the golden triangle. This is ancient city full of historic and beautiful temples. Bhubaneswar means Lord of Universe which reflects in religious fever of locals. Lingaraj temple and the Parasurameswara temple are must visit places. The place is also endowed with a green canopy of forests which makes it a haven for daredevils.

1. Bhitarkanika National Park, Kendrapara - Known for its rich mangrove ecosystem and diverse wildlife including saltwater crocodiles and migratory birds. (Approximately 130 km from Bhubaneswar)
2. Cuttack - The former capital of Odisha, Cuttack is known for its historical significance and architectural wonders like Barabati Fort, Odisha State Maritime Museum, and Stone Revetment. (Approximately 30 km from Bhubaneswar)
3. Jajpur - Famous for its ancient temples like Biraja Temple, Ratnagiri Buddhist Excavation, and Saptamatruka Temple. (Approximately 90 km from Bhubaneswar)
4. Chandipur Beach, Balasore - A unique beach where the sea recedes about 5 km during low tide, allowing visitors to walk on the seabed. (Approximately 245 km from Bhubaneswar)
5. Simlipal National Park, Mayurbhanj - Known for its lush green forests, waterfalls, and a variety of wildlife including tigers, elephants, and leopards. (Approximately 320 km from Bhubaneswar)
